Full Description

Show more
Specifies plant palettes for prime contractors on City of Marina park projects, focusing on specialty Asian specimen plantings and California native plants. Selects species compatible with the Four Seasons theme, local coastal climate, and wetland environments. Requires horticultural certification or a degree in Botany/Horticulture. Delivers planting plans and specimen plant lists.

Asian American Garden At Locke-Paddon Wetland Community Park
Solicitation # 20260731016
The City of Marina has issued a Request for Qualifications for the Asian American Garden project located at Locke-Paddon Wetland Community Park. The City is seeking experienced landscape architectural consultants to provide comprehensive design and construction support services, including pre-design, site investigation, preliminary and final design, bid support, and project closeout. The project scope involves creating a culturally significant landscape themed around the Four Seasons, featuring infrastructure such as universally accessible walkways, bridges, and decking, alongside water features like meandering streams, waterfalls, and ponds, as well as a focal pavilion and meditation rock gardens. Key deliverables include 30 percent and 60 percent design submittals, followed by a final package of plans, technical specifications, and engineer's estimates suitable for bidding and construction. Selection will be based on qualifications rather than price, with the City ranking consultants to create a shortlist for potential interviews. The evaluation process uses weighted criteria including management approach (20%), relevant experience (20%), organization (15%), reputation (15%), understanding of project goals (10%), familiarity with the locality (10%), and the breadth of services offered (10%). Qualified teams must demonstrate expertise in Asian garden design, specialty Asian and California native plant materials, large-scale sustainable water features, and universally accessible design. Proposals must be submitted electronically in two separate PDF volumes—one for the technical proposal and one for the confidential not-to-exceed cost proposal—by 4:00 p.m. on September 28, 2026. All consultants must comply with local, state, and federal regulations, including non-discrimination requirements and prevailing wage laws.
